Aurea Imaging wants to develop image analysis technology for drones/Unmanned Aerial Vehicles (UAVs) to use them in the agricultural sector to detect deviations. These deviations may indicate harmful organisms. In a testing ground of the Dutch Food and Consumer Product Safety Authority (NVWA) we are investigating the feasibility of this technology. The detection of these anomalies using AI has 3 purposes: A more efficient use of resources for inspection (inspection, lab, deployment of equipment), Improving inspection methods of the Netherlands Food and Consumer Product Safety Authority, Achieve higher food safety through better controls.
